VETERINARY CLUB.

THE HAURAKI PLAINS BODY. MONTHLY EXECUTIVE MEETING. The monthly meeting of the executive of the Farmers’ Veterinary Club was held .at Ngatea yesterday, Mr A. J. Andrews presiding over Messrs C. H. Waite, R. Burke. G. Phillips, R. Rowlings, C. W. Schultz, and C. A. Gibson, secretary. MEMBERSHIP. One new member was enrolled, anol two resignations were accepted from members who had given up dairyingseveral members wrote resigning;, but these applications were refused! and in some eases the clubs’ solicitor was intstructed to sue for the outstanding subscriptions and money due for services and medicine. It was pointed out by speakers that all members should know that a resignation must be banded in by March 31 to be effiecWxe for the following year. The resignation of a Torehape member was accepted, it being the policy of the club to confine its membership to farmers residing within reasonable distance of metalled roads,. FINANCE. In reply to the chairman the secretary reported that the cash in hand! amounted to - about £7. AU salaries, were paid up to date. Accounts totalling £ll Is ltd were passed for payment when funds per- . mitted. SERVICES OF SURGEON. Numerous complaints Were made by members concerning the action of the surgeon in attending non-members without permission from the executive, and a course of action was decided upon. . PROVISION OF A CAR. The question of providing the surgeon with a motor-car was discussed at length, and it was decided that the chairman go into the matter thoroughly and report to the next meeting. The surgeon was to be asked t 6. attend the meeting to discuss .the matter. • .
